Sunscreen spray is a product that many people use and it is also a relatively convenient product. So is sunscreen spray waterproof? Is spray sunscreen harmful to your skin? Is sunscreen spray waterproof? General sunscreen sprays have a certain anti-sweat effect, but their waterproof function is not very good. Of course, if you buy a sunscreen spray specifically with a waterproof effect, that is a different matter. It is recommended that you do not spray it directly on your face. Spray the sunscreen spray on your hands first and then pat it on your face. Do not spray it directly on your face because the spray generally contains alcohol and spraying it directly on your face will cause damage. If the nozzle sprays large droplets of water, you can only spray it on your hands first and then apply it on your face. Is sunscreen spray harmful to the skin? Sunscreen spray is harmful to the skin.
